Overview

After the harrowing events at Mill House, Zoey, Len, and Poulton are irrevocably changed. Poulton is haunted by his demonic possession and Zoey is paralysed with no hope of recovery. That is, unless Len can find the mother whom she brutally banished more than a hundred years ago.

Finding Roan will be no small feat. First Len will need to face a past locked out of her memory and travel the darkest paths of the Conjure.

To keep her away from danger, Len must leave Zoey in the last place she wants to: the convent where Len spent her childhood, a century and a half earlier. But the Sisterhood of the Sparrows may not be the haven Len assumed, and when the Beast comes whispering, the embittered Zoey may be too susceptible to temptation.

Bleak and gruesome, gloomy and Gothic, tortuous and savage, in this follow up to Teeth in the Mist Dawn Kurtagich continues to redefine the horror and fantasy space.

About the Author

Dawn Kurtagich is the award-winning author of The Dead House, The Creeperman / And the Trees Crept In, and Teeth in the Mist. The daughter of a British globe-trotter single mother, her formative years were spent in Africa-on a mission, in the bush, in the city, and in the desert. By the time she was eighteen, she had been to fifteen schools across two continents. While still in her teens, she did an internship at Cambridge's prestigious Cavendish Laboratories. At the age of 25, she received a life-saving liver transplant. Her debut novel, The Dead House, was a YALSA Top 10 Pick, An Audie and Earphone Award Nominee, and an Earie Award Winner. It was optioned for TV by Lime Productions. She leaves her North Wales crypt after midnight during blood moons. The rest of the time she exists somewhere between mushrooms, maggots, and mould.
